1995-1996 Hyundai Accent Radiator: Solving the Manual vs. Automatic Puzzle

This guide clarifies the critical differences between manual and automatic radiators for the first-generation Accent and shows you how to diagnose common cooling system failures.

The radiator is the heart of your Accent's engine cooling system. Its job is to dissipate heat from the engine coolant that circulates through it. Hot coolant from the engine flows into the radiator's core, which is made of many small tubes and fins. As air passes over these fins, it draws heat away from the coolant. The now-cooler fluid then circulates back into the engine to absorb more heat. For models with an automatic transmission, the radiator has an additional, separate circuit inside one of the tanks that cools the transmission fluid, preventing the transmission from overheating.

Compatibility: The Most Important Check

Side-by-side comparison of a manual transmission radiator without ports and an automatic transmission radiator with oil cooler fittings for a 1995-1996 Hyundai Accent.
The critical difference: Manual radiators (left) lack the transmission oil cooler ports found on automatic models (right).

For the 1995-1996 Hyundai Accent, choosing the correct radiator is not as simple as just matching the year. There are critical differences based on your vehicle's transmission type and, in some cases, the engine. Failure to select the correct part will lead to installation problems or system damage.

Warning: The primary difference is between radiators for automatic and manual transmissions. They are not directly interchangeable without understanding the modifications needed.

Automatic vs. Manual Transmission Radiators

The key difference is the presence of an integrated transmission oil cooler.

  • Automatic Transmission Radiators: These units have an extra set of small ports, usually at the bottom of the radiator. Two lines from the automatic transmission connect to these ports, allowing transmission fluid to be cooled by the radiator.
  • Manual Transmission Radiators: These units do not have the internal transmission cooler and lack the extra ports.

You can physically identify which type you need by looking at your current radiator. If you see two small-diameter metal lines going into the bottom tank in addition to the large upper and lower coolant hoses, you have an automatic transmission.

Engine-Specific Variations (SOHC vs. DOHC)

While transmission type is the main factor, some part numbers also specify the engine type (SOHC or DOHC). This is most common for 1996 models. This may be due to minor differences in hose inlet/outlet angles or mounting tab locations. Always verify which engine your Accent has before ordering.

Transmission Type Engine Type Known OEM Part Numbers Key Features
Automatic 1.5L SOHC or DOHC 25310-22050, 25310-22070, 25310-22B00, 25310-22B70 Includes ports for transmission cooler lines.
Manual 1.5L DOHC (Specifically 1996) 25310-22025 No transmission cooler ports. Specific fit for DOHC models.
Manual 1.5L SOHC 25310-22A00 No transmission cooler ports. Specific fit for SOHC models.

Symptoms of a Failing Radiator

A close-up of milky, pink, frothy transmission fluid on a dipstick, indicating an internal radiator leak.
On automatic models, an internal failure can mix coolant with transmission fluid, creating a 'strawberry milkshake' appearance.

A bad radiator can cause catastrophic engine damage if ignored. Watch for these warning signs.

1. Engine Overheating

This is the most critical symptom. If you see the temperature gauge climbing into the red zone or the temperature warning light comes on, your cooling system is not working properly. Pull over as soon as it is safe to do so and shut off the engine to prevent severe damage like a warped cylinder head.

2. Visible Coolant Leaks

Finding a puddle of bright green, yellow, or pink fluid under the front of your car is a sure sign of a leak. As radiators age, the plastic end tanks can become brittle and crack, or corrosion can create pinholes in the aluminum core. Look for wet spots or crusty, colorful residue on the radiator itself.

3. Sweet Smell

Leaking coolant can drip or spray onto hot engine parts, creating steam with a distinctively sweet, syrupy smell. If you notice this smell while driving or after parking, you likely have a coolant leak that needs immediate attention.

4. Low Coolant Level

If you have to add coolant to the overflow reservoir frequently, it's leaking out from somewhere. While the leak could be from a hose or the water pump, the radiator is a common culprit. A healthy cooling system is sealed and should not consume coolant.

5. Contaminated or Rusty Coolant

When you check your coolant, it should be a clean, transparent color. If it looks brown, rusty, or has sludge in it, this indicates internal corrosion in the cooling system. This debris can clog the narrow tubes of the radiator, preventing it from cooling effectively.

6. Transmission Problems (Automatic Models Only)

If the internal transmission cooler fails, coolant can mix with your automatic transmission fluid. This can cause poor shifting, slipping, or complete transmission failure. If you check your transmission fluid and it looks milky or pink and frothy, this is a sign of a major internal radiator leak.

Diagnosing a Faulty Radiator

A mechanic using a cooling system pressure tester on a vehicle's radiator to identify leaks.
A pressure test is the most reliable way to find pinhole leaks or cracks in the radiator end tanks.
  1. Visual Inspection: With the engine cool, use a flashlight to carefully inspect the entire radiator. Look for cracks in the black plastic tanks on the top/bottom or sides, white or colored crusty stains indicating slow leaks, and areas of bent or corroded cooling fins.
  2. Pressure Test: The most reliable way to find a leak is with a cooling system pressure tester. This tool can be rented from most auto parts stores. You attach it to the radiator neck and pump it up to the pressure specified on the radiator cap (usually 12-15 PSI). If the pressure drops, there is a leak in the system. You can then look and listen for the escaping air or dripping coolant to pinpoint the source.
  3. Check for Clogs: After the engine has run and is at operating temperature, carefully feel the surface of the radiator (do not touch the hot hoses or moving fan!). If you find significant cold spots, it means coolant is not flowing through those sections, indicating an internal clog.

Buying a Used Radiator: What to Look For

A good-condition used OEM radiator can be a reliable and cost-effective choice, often providing better fit and quality than a cheap aftermarket alternative. Here’s how to inspect one.

  • Verify Compatibility: First and foremost, confirm it's the correct part for your Accent's transmission and engine type using the guide above. For an automatic, ensure the transmission cooler fittings are present and the threads are in good condition.
  • Inspect the Plastic Tanks: The most common failure point is cracking of the plastic end tanks. Examine them closely under good light for any hairline cracks, especially around the hose connections and mounting points.
  • Look Inside: Peer into the inlet and outlet ports. Look for heavy scale buildup or a powdery, chunky residue, which could be a sign that a previous owner used a "stop-leak" additive. This additive can clog the radiator and your engine's cooling passages, and should be avoided.
  • Check the Fins: A few bent fins are normal and can be carefully straightened with a small screwdriver. However, avoid radiators with large areas of flattened or crumbling fins, as this will significantly reduce cooling efficiency.
  • Examine the Seams: Look at the metal tabs where the aluminum core is crimped to the plastic end tanks. Check for any signs of leakage, like white or green stains.
  • Mileage is a Factor: Radiators are a wear item. A part from a low-mileage vehicle is always preferable to one from a high-mileage car, as it has been subjected to fewer heat cycles and less potential for internal corrosion.

Related Parts to Replace

New upper and lower radiator hoses and a thermostat for a 1995-1996 Hyundai Accent.
When replacing the radiator, it is highly recommended to install new hoses and a fresh thermostat to ensure system reliability.

Pro Tip: When replacing the radiator, you have already drained the cooling system. This is the perfect time to replace other inexpensive cooling system components as preventative maintenance.

  • Radiator Hoses: The upper and lower radiator hoses can become soft, brittle, or swollen over time. Replacing them now is cheap insurance against a future failure.
  • Thermostat: This small valve controls the flow of coolant. If it sticks closed, your engine will overheat even with a new radiator.
  • Radiator Cap: The cap holds pressure in the system, which raises the boiling point of the coolant. A weak cap can lead to boil-overs.
  • Coolant: Never reuse old coolant. Refill the system with fresh, new coolant mixed to the proper concentration (usually 50/50 with distilled water). For this era of vehicle, a traditional green IAT (Inorganic Acid Technology) coolant is appropriate, but be sure to flush the system if changing types.

Known Issues, Recalls, and TSBs

As of this writing, there are no specific NHTSA recalls or widespread Technical Service Bulletins (TSBs) for the radiator on 1995-1996 Hyundai Accents. Failures are typically due to age, corrosion, or physical damage rather than a specific design defect.

Frequently Asked Questions (FAQ)

What type of coolant should I use in my 1995-1996 Accent?

The original coolant for this vehicle was a conventional green Inorganic Acid Technology (IAT) antifreeze. You can continue to use this type, flushing the system every 2 years or 30,000 miles. Alternatively, you can flush the system completely and switch to a modern, long-life universal coolant that is compatible with all makes and models. The cooling system capacity is approximately 5.8 quarts.

Can I use a radiator for an automatic transmission in my manual transmission Accent?

Yes, this is generally possible. Aftermarket suppliers often only sell the automatic version to cover both applications. You would simply leave the two small transmission cooler ports uncapped or loosely capped to prevent debris from entering. Do NOT use a manual transmission radiator in an automatic car, as there will be no way to cool the transmission fluid.

Why is my car still overheating after I replaced the radiator?

If a new radiator doesn't solve your overheating problem, the issue lies elsewhere. The most common cause is air trapped in the cooling system, which needs to be properly "bled." Other potential causes include a faulty thermostat that is stuck closed, a failing water pump, a bad radiator cap that isn't holding pressure, or a malfunctioning cooling fan.

Is replacing the radiator a difficult DIY job?

For a mechanically inclined person with basic tools, replacing the radiator on a 1995-1996 Accent is a manageable job. It typically involves draining the coolant, removing the fan shroud, disconnecting the hoses (and transmission lines if applicable), unbolting the old radiator, and installing the new one in reverse order. The most critical step is properly refilling and bleeding the system of air afterwards to prevent overheating.

Technical Specifications

OEM Part Numbers: 25310-22000 25310-22005 25310-22020 25310-22025 25310-22050 25310-22070 25310-22120 25310-22170 25310-22A00 25310-22B00 25310-22B70

Cooling System Capacity: Approx. 5.8 quarts (5.5 Liters). System Pressure: Determined by radiator cap, typically 12-15 PSI.
